Details
A vulnerability was found in Microsoft Office 2007 SP3/2010 SP2/2013 RT SP1/2013 SP1 (Office Suite Software). It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ects an un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a out-of-bounds v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-125. The product reads data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er. Impacted is confidentiality.
The bug was discovered 12/13/2016. The weakness was published 12/13/2016 by Steven Vittitoe with Google Project Zero as MS16-148 as confirmed bulletin (Technet). The advisory is shared at technet.microsoft.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2016-7276 since 09/09/2016. The attack may be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available.
The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 95810 (MS16-148: Security Update for Microsoft Office (3204068) (macOS)),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family MacOS X Local Security Checks and running in the context l.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 110292 (Microsoft Office Remote Code Execution Vulnerabilities (MS16-148)).
Applying the patch MS16-148 is able to eliminate this problem. The bugfix is ready for download at technet.microsoft.com. A possible mitigation has been published immediately after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
